The same on IBM T22 but there you can use this workaround:
just add the following line to your /etc/modules
apm power_off=1
If you shutdown now it still does not work, but from that time on it does.
Testet with two T22's.
(btw: I added the kernelparameter "acpi=off" and "noapic")

Public bug reported:
Binary package hint: python-twisted-mail
This package import python-openssl when connecting to a SSL enabled mail server.
python-twisted-mail don't depend on it, neither it's own dependencies.
installing it, fix everything.
still present in Hardy.
